Auto insurance: Expected Increase in Sales for 2011

The past years have been particularly marked in the field of car insurance of a real price war in the battle for customers. Insurance industry made losses in particular. That should change in 2011, however.

The expected GDV for the year 2011, a rise in sales at the car insurance.
The General Association of German Insurers (GDV) is optimistic about the coming year. After losing the previous fiscal years that tried to undercut the insurance industry, especially in the automotive sector with low rates will continue to get each other to the premium - and thus the revenues - the insurers get back in perspective. This is true across industries, but especially for car insurance.



GDV is even talk of a real turnaround. This is expected for the first time in six years, a slight increase in sales. In the field of life insurance to substantial increases in new customers are expected, this mainly due to the huge demand for policies with single amounts that are often used as short-term investment. Overall, the revenue of the German insurer will in 2011 increase by 4.7 percent.

Significant growth is expected also in the field of credit insurance, legal expenses cover and accident insurance. Nevertheless, to the underwriting profit in the property and casualty insurance companies to contract. This GDV justified by the still unfavorable loss ratio. German insurer must pay for any damage to more and more, the industry association. It was in this form since the Elbe flood in 2001 has been there.
